Your own WireGuard VPS
for private VPN hosting

Modern VPN protocol with kernel-level performance and minimal attack surface. NVMe storage, 10 Gbps port, ready in under 60 seconds.

expand_circle_down Discover more
root@wireguard-vps ~
$ wg show
interface: wg0
  public key: aB3dE...xYz=
  listening port: 51820
peer: cD4fG...wVu=
  endpoint: 203.0.113.1:51820
  latest handshake: 12 seconds ago
  transfer: 2.48 GiB received, 1.09 GiB sent
WireGuard
Automatic WireGuard VPS
Deployment
View Plans

What is a WireGuard VPS?

WireGuard is a next-generation VPN protocol designed for simplicity, speed and security. Unlike legacy VPN solutions, WireGuard operates with roughly 4,000 lines of code running directly in the Linux kernel. This minimal footprint translates to faster connections, lower latency and a dramatically smaller attack surface.

Running WireGuard on a cloud VPS gives you a private VPN server under your full control. Route your internet traffic through an encrypted tunnel, access your home or office network remotely, or connect distributed team members securely — all without trusting a commercial VPN provider with your data.

With 10 Gbps networking and NVMe storage on RDPCore infrastructure, your WireGuard VPS delivers near-wire-speed VPN performance. Add peers in seconds with simple configuration files or QR codes, and enjoy seamless roaming between networks.

rocket_launch
Instant Deploy
Ready in under 60 seconds
public
EU Datacenter
Low latency, GDPR-ready hosting
network_check
10 Gbps Network
20 TB included
layers
Consistent Stack
Same environment every time

Why run your own WireGuard VPS?

Commercial VPN services promise privacy but route your traffic through shared infrastructure you don’t control. With a self-hosted WireGuard VPN, you are the only user on the server.

WireGuard’s kernel-level implementation means your VPN runs with minimal CPU overhead. Unlike OpenVPN which operates in userspace, WireGuard processes packets directly in the kernel — resulting in higher throughput and lower latency.

Simple configuration, modern cryptography

WireGuard uses Curve25519 for key exchange, ChaCha20 for encryption, Poly1305 for authentication and BLAKE2s for hashing. There are no cipher suites to negotiate and no complex PKI infrastructure. Each peer is identified by a simple public key.

Seamless roaming and always-on connectivity

WireGuard handles network changes gracefully. Switch from Wi-Fi to mobile data, change networks or wake your laptop from sleep — WireGuard re-establishes the tunnel silently without dropping connections.

Why RDPCore for WireGuard VPS hosting?

VPN performance is all about network speed and low latency. Our EU-based datacenter with 10 Gbps networking delivers the throughput WireGuard was designed to utilize. Combined with instant provisioning, full root access and dedicated resources, RDPCore gives you a VPN server that’s fast, private and entirely under your control.

View WireGuard VPS Plans arrow_forward

WireGuard VPS Hosting — FAQ

What is a WireGuard VPS?add
A VPS with WireGuard VPN pre-installed for high-performance encrypted tunneling.
How fast is WireGuard compared to OpenVPN?add
WireGuard runs in the kernel with minimal overhead — typically 2–4x faster throughput than OpenVPN.
How many clients can connect?add
No hard limit. Depends on your plan's CPU and bandwidth resources.
Can I use WireGuard for site-to-site VPN?add
Yes, configure point-to-point or hub-and-spoke topologies with full root access.
Do I get full root access?add
Yes, full root via SSH. Modify WireGuard configs and firewall rules freely.
What ports does WireGuard use?add
UDP port 51820 by default, configurable to any port.
Is DDoS protection included?add
Yes, always-on DDoS protection included at no extra cost.
Can I run other services alongside WireGuard?add
Yes, install any additional software with full root access.
Is the connection encrypted?add
Yes, WireGuard uses state-of-the-art Noise protocol with ChaCha20 and Curve25519.
How fast is deployment?add
Under 60 seconds. WireGuard is ready for client connections immediately.

Explore More Apps

OpenVPNOpenVPN VPSarrow_forward NGINXNGINX VPSarrow_forward